Output f888c6151a7c65924f474eb7dbb73dc574513d5c59b8346f14417d9e340839d7:33

value
262195
script pubkey
OP_0 OP_PUSHBYTES_20 e1220bf7dc080c25cd8313eef454e6ba5a65df33
address
bc1quy3qha7upqxztnvrz0h0g48xhfdxthenfx4xvm
transaction
f888c6151a7c65924f474eb7dbb73dc574513d5c59b8346f14417d9e340839d7
confirmations
132087
spent
true